Piecewise-linear division of region by neural networks with maximum detectors
Abstract
A neural network with maximum detectors divides a space which has n-dimensions R(n) into piecewise-linear regions. However, there have been very limited theoretical researches concerning what kind of piecewise-linear region divisions can be realized by a neural network, that is, concerning the formation capability of piecewise-linear discriminate regions by a neural network. In this paper, this problem is considered theoretically. The concept of a individual region is introduced and then it is proved that a division can be realized by a piecewise-linear machine if and only if it is k-dividual.
